Laminated Shims SPIROL produces precision shims with or without a tool to meet lead-time and total cost considerations. Shims are thin pieces of material often used as compensators to fill in small gaps between objects aligning parts, reducing wear and absorbing tolerances between mating components. Shims can also significantly reduce manufacturing time and costs as they eliminate the need for each component to be precision machined in order to achieve the proper fit and function of the total assembly... THE ADVANTAGES OF USING EDGE BONDED SHIMS Precision Shims are used as compensators to absorb tolerances between mating components. They significantly reduce manufacturing costs by eliminating the need for each component to be precision machined in order to achieve the proper fit and function of the total assembly. During the assembly process, Shims provide adjustment to compensate for accumulated tolerances that significantly reduces the need for re-machining and assembly time. High hardness and dimensional stability make tungsten carbide balls the preferred choice for precision hydraulic valves, high-load bearings, inertial navigation systems, ball screws, linear bearings in slideways, gauging and checking instruments, and meters. Tungsten carbide balls are also used for ballizing, to work harden, and improve fretting fatigue strength. Characteristics. Tungsten carbide balls are ideal for applications where extreme hardness... Reduce Radiation Exposure with Tungsten Shielding Several applications require shielding from radiation where lead is not a feasible material. Tungsten heavy alloy provides an alternative to lead that is strong and highly customizable into precision components. With an approximately 1.7 times greater density than lead, tungsten guarantees radiation exposure is kept to a minimum. Benefits Of Using Tungsten. Tungsten 's higher density means the material provides better gamma ray absorption and radiation shielding. Not only is tungsten thicker...
